Exploring the Benefits of Prefabricated Steel Staircase Systems in Modern Construction
Prefabricated steel staircase systems are becoming increasingly popular in the construction and architectural industries due to their numerous advantages over traditional building methods. These systems are designed to be manufactured off-site and then transported to the construction site for quick assembly. This approach offers significant time and cost savings, making it a preferred choice for many builders and contractors.
One of the most prominent benefits of prefabricated steel staircase systems is their speed of installation. Since the components are prefabricated in a controlled environment, they can be assembled quickly once they arrive on-site. This rapid installation reduces project timelines, allowing for faster completion of buildings. Additionally, less on-site labor is required, which can further cut down on overall costs and minimize disruptions during the construction phase.
Durability is another key advantage of steel staircase systems. Steel is known for its strength and resistance to wear, making it an excellent material choice for high-traffic areas. These staircases can withstand heavy loads and are less susceptible to damage from environmental factors, such as moisture or pests, compared to wood or other traditional materials. This quality not only ensures safety but also reduces the need for frequent maintenance and repairs, ultimately leading to long-term savings.
Aesthetic versatility is also a hallmark of prefabricated steel staircase systems. They can be designed to suit a wide variety of architectural styles, from modern and industrial to more traditional designs. This adaptability allows architects and designers to incorporate these staircases seamlessly into their projects, enhancing the overall visual appeal of the space. Additionally, steel can be finished in various colors and textures, offering clients the opportunity to customize their staircases to align with their branding or personal tastes.
Moreover, prefabricated steel staircase systems contribute to sustainable building practices. Steel is a recyclable material, and using prefabricated components can reduce waste generated during construction. By streamlining the building process, these systems also minimize the environmental impact associated with traditional construction methods.
In conclusion, prefabricated steel staircase systems are an innovative solution that addresses multiple challenges faced by the construction industry today. Their rapid installation, durability, aesthetic versatility, and contribution to sustainability make them an excellent choice for builders, architects, and clients alike. As the demand for efficient and eco-friendly construction solutions continues to grow, the adoption of prefabricated steel staircase systems is likely to increase, paving the way for more advanced building techniques in the future.
